MONTHLY LUNCHEON MEETING

Fire Prevention, Safety & NY State Code Changes

Presented by: Chief Richard Lyman & Richard Nagle

Thursday ~~ October 14, 2010

Crowne Plaza Hotel, White Plains, NY

October is Fire Protection Month and BOMA is pleased to present a program featuring two keynote speakers exceptionally qualified to address fire prevention, fire safety, fire codes and enforcement.  Recent changes in Chapter 4, Emergency Planning and Preparedness, of the Fire Code of New York will be going into effect December 14th of this year.   Our presenters will be discussing how the changes will affect commercial buildings and specifically how they can assist you and your properties to comply with the new code.

The Building Owners and Managers Association (BOMA) International is a federation of 88 BOMA U.S. associations and 18 international affiliates. Founded in 1907, BOMA represents the owners and managers of all commercial property types including nearly 10.5 billion square feet of U.S. office space that supports 1.7 million jobs and contributes $234.9 billion to the U.S. GDP. Its mission is to advance a vibrant commercial real estate industry through advocacy, influence and knowledge.​​
